Output 51ef324760911e1c40330b1180ae5dd52684271dabf4b84eb88613cc200d6c27:0

value
17989400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4781a16bb8aec5a4759f68088673d7f832ec6075 OP_EQUAL
address
38D7C3ywTPVKnup23pEQHcUmhC9ZuEy5rM
transaction
51ef324760911e1c40330b1180ae5dd52684271dabf4b84eb88613cc200d6c27
spent
true